Georgia: War With Russia Poll

Social Science in the Caucasus comments on a telephone opinion poll conducted in the aftermath of the recent Russia-Georgia conflict over South Ossetia. Although the specialist blog says that this is the first time it has heard of the pollsters, it provides its readers with the results in which 42.4 percent considered that the war was avoidable and 46.7 percent believed that it wasn't. The blog concludes that if the poll is accurate, society in Georgia might well be split on the matter.
